What Is The Creators Legal Platform?

Creators Legal, launched in September 2021, is an online platform that offers legal services to creators of content on the internet. They want to make it as easy as possible to legally protect your content, even if you’re not an expert in contracts.

Creators Legal provides creators with a wide variety of custom contracts created by seasoned content and media attorneys, as well as the resources you need to adapt to the dynamic nature of the creator industry.

How Does Creators Legal Work?

There are over 200 contracts offered on the platform. For a low one-time fee or a regular subscription, you can document, finalize, and file your legal agreements in a digital suitcase in minutes.

Every step of the procedure on the Creators Legal platform is quick, easy, and intuitive.

First, creators need to sign up for a free account, and then they can select from among many different contracts and pre-made bundles. The contracts currently offered include those for content creators, social influencers, self-publishing, filmmakers, podcasters, musicians, photographers, web series, artists & galleries, and NFT creators.

Contracts Offered by Creators Legal

Some of the specialized contracts offered include an Influencer Agreement, Digital Creator (Tiktok reels), Talent Agreement, Podcast Sponsorship, Podcast Guest Release, NFT Developer Agreement, Film Director and Editor Agreements, Influencer Sponsorship, Photographer Contract, Social Media Brand Ambassador, and much more.

Intuitively navigating this site is a breeze, and your contracts are easily tailored to the individual needs of your projects with the help of their built-in Form Builder.

After preparing your contract, acquiring all parties’ signatures takes only a few clicks, thanks to their speedy and secure signature system powered by HelloSign.

Project Briefcase is a free, secure dashboard that allows the creator to keep track of all contracts, from first drafts to finalized, paid, and signed versions, and provides instant access to any of these documents by download or sharing.

Pricing

You can select from three different pricing tiers. Starting at $19, their single-use contracts are very affordable. A monthly unlimited-use plan is $40.00 per month, and their annual subscription plan is just $108.00 (which works out to only $9.00 a month).

Legal Disclaimer: Though I’m an attorney, this article should not be considered legal advice. And with any contract template package you buy online, I highly recommend you take the templates you create to an attorney to have them looked over and tweaked as necessary to fully comply with the requirements of your state or country’s laws.
